Technical field
The present invention relates to communication technical field, more particularly to a kind of data transmission device and its method for transmitting data.
Background technology
For most of clique enterprises and institutions, its institutional framework is relative complex, may include general headquarters and multiple Branch company.Because general headquarters and each branch company's Regional Distribution are wider, general headquarters and each branch company would generally use different business System realizes its business, meanwhile, it is also required to transmit corresponding business datum between different business systems to realize co-ordination.
At present, the point-to-point data transfer mode transmission services data of generally use between different business systems, work as local terminal When operation system is needed to multiple opposite end operation systems transmission identical business datum, local terminal operation system needs to carry out largely Repeated work, data transmission efficiency are relatively low.

For more clear explanation technical scheme and advantage, below with local terminal operation system A to opposite end industry Exemplified by business system B, C sends business datum X, Y, as shown in figure 4, can specifically include following each step:
Step 401, operation system A sends business datum X, Y to the first of corresponding data transmission device a successively Storage region.
In the embodiment of the present invention, specifically with operation system A, B, C, corresponding data transmission device is a, b, c successively respectively, And a, b, c share an event center, exemplified by the event center is connected with operation system A, B, C respectively.
Step 402, data transmission device a the first storage region receives and stores the business of local terminal operation system A transmissions Data X, Y.
Step 403, data transmission device a message generating unit is when the first storage region receives business datum X, shape Message x is sent into the data corresponding to business datum X;Data transmission device a message generating unit connects in the first storage region When receiving business datum Y, form the data corresponding to business datum Y and send message y.
Step 404, data transmission device a monitoring processing unit listen to message generating unit formed data send disappear During breath, the data of formation are sent into message and are added to message queue.
It will be apparent that can include message x and message y in message queue, wherein message x is located at head of the queue, and message y is located at Tail of the queue.
Step 405, data transmission device a data transmission unit sends adding for message x, y according to data in message queue Add order, a non-selected current service data is selected from the first storage region, the current service data of selection is passed Transport to opposite end operation system B, C distinguish corresponding to data transmission device b, c the second storage region, and to event center send Corresponding to the triggering information of current service data.
It will be apparent that data transmission device a data transmission unit can select first data send message x pair The business datum X answered, and business datum X is transmitted separately to data transmission device b, c the second storage region.
Follow-up each step of the embodiment of the present invention is only exemplified by for business datum X handle accordingly.
Step 406, event center is when receiving the triggering information corresponding to business datum X, to opposite end operation system B, C Send a notification message respectively.
Step 407, opposite end operation system B, C is when receiving the notification message of event center transmission, opposite end operation system B Read business datum X from data transmission device b the second storage region, opposite end operation system C from data transmission device c the Business datum X is read in two storage regions.
Step 408, operation system B in opposite end generates and sends correspondingly when successfully reading business datum X to event center Receipt is received in business datum X first, opposite end operation system C is when successfully reading business datum X, to event center generation simultaneously Send and receive receipt corresponding to the second of business datum X.
Step 409, the first reception receipt and the second reception receipt are received back to hold and are forwarded to the local terminal industry by event center Business system A.
In this way, local terminal operation system then can be by judging whether to receive opposite end operation system B and opposite end operation system C points The first of center transmission of other passage time receives receipt and second and receives receipt, to judge opposite end operation system B and opposite end business Whether system C is successfully received business datum X, so that operation system B or opposite end operation system C fail to successfully receive business During data X, the business operation such as to business datum X resend.
It is visible by above-mentioned each step of the embodiment of the present invention, point-to-point number is no longer used between each operation system According to transmission means, when local terminal operation system needs to send business datum to multiple opposite end operation systems, without local terminal business system System carries out substantial amounts of repeated work, meanwhile, can be each corresponding by it between local terminal operation system and each opposite end operation system Data transmission device realize asynchronous receiving-transmitting business datum, data transmission efficiency is higher.
